What is Mindfulness?

Mindfulness is the practice of being present and fully engaged in the current moment, while cultivating a non-judgmental awareness of one’s thoughts, feelings, and bodily sensations. It involves paying attention to the present moment with openness, curiosity, and a willingness to be with what is, as it is. Mindfulness is not about achieving a specific state or outcome, but rather about cultivating a greater awareness and acceptance of the present moment.
Benefits of Mindfulness

The benefits of mindfulness practices are numerous and well-documented. Some of the most significant benefits include:
- Reduced stress and anxiety
- Improved emotional regulation
- Increased self-awareness
- Enhanced cognitive function
- Improved relationships
- Increased overall sense of well-being
Mindfulness Practices for Daily Living

So, how can you incorporate mindfulness practices into your daily life? Here are some tips to get you started:
- Meditation: Start with short periods of meditation, such as 5-10 minutes per day, and gradually increase as you become more comfortable with the practice. You can use guided meditation apps or videos to help you get started.
- Yoga: Yoga is a great way to cultivate mindfulness while also improving flexibility and balance. You can find yoga classes in your local area or follow along with online videos.
- Deep Breathing: Deep breathing is a simple yet powerful mindfulness practice that can be done anywhere, at any time. Simply focus on your breath, feeling the sensation of the air moving in and out of your body.
- Body Scan: Lie down or sit comfortably, and bring your attention to different parts of your body, starting from your toes and moving up to the top of your head. Notice any areas of tension or relaxation, and allow yourself to release any stress or discomfort.
- Walking: Take a walk, either in a natural setting or in a busy city, and pay attention to the sensation of your feet touching the ground. Notice the sights, sounds, and smells around you, and allow yourself to be fully present in the moment.
